Logistics and Location

Introduction to Spinning Local Wool on a Traditional Spinning Wheel - Logistics and Location

Nestled above the YoYo store in a terraced apartment with a breathtaking view, the workshop’s meeting point at 11 Pl. du Buoc, 82140 Saint-Antonin-Noble-Val, France awaits participants for an immersive spinning experience. The location offers not just a cozy setup but also a stunning backdrop for the craft session. For easy navigation, a Google Maps link is provided to ensure attendees find their way seamlessly.

The pickup time is set for 02:00 PM, and confirmation is sent within 48 hours of booking. While the venue isn’t wheelchair accessible, it accommodates strollers and service animals.
